BUZZ-Symbotic rises after co to acquire Walmart's robotics business

ReutersJan 16, 2025 12:00 PM

Shares of robotics vendor Symbotic SYM.O up 13.5% at $30.39 premarket after co to acquire retail bellwether Walmart's advanced systems and robotics business for $200 mln in cash

Symbotic to develop an "advanced solution" to automate Walmart's Accelerated Pickup and Delivery centers (APD), with an initial order covering hundreds of stores, co says in a statement

Symbotic to also participate in a development program funded by Walmart to enhance current online pickup and delivery fulfillment systems and to design new systems

If performance criteria are achieved, Walmart committed to purchasing and deploying systems for 400 APDs at stores over a multi-year period and adding additional APDs in the coming years

Deal expected to close in SYM's fiscal Q2, 2025

In 2024, SYM's stock fell 53.8%
